The Weekend Run Club Chicago, Illinois

The Weekend Run Club is a five-piece band that combines the technical guitar stylings of alternative rock with the upbeat, dance feel of indie pop music. The band released their debut EP, "Okay For You," in September 2019.

2020 marks a new wave of music from the group with the newly released album, “Zoo,” a twelve-track escapade through themes of heartbreak, self-identity, grief, and love.
